How much does an assistant general manager earn in Fort Smith, AR?

The average assistant general manager in Fort Smith, AR earns between $20,000 and $42,000 annually. This compares to the national average assistant general manager range of $35,000 to $73,000.

Average assistant general manager salary in Fort Smith, AR

$29,000
